Output d616914b875f3e19aedf4b5a59d43e3fb1bf0796cc526c63ff5b41c075c30f57:4

value
10476122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3870c8c072b98be54b80393052dfe2ff4afe8f58 OP_EQUAL
address
MD3bBZATZWehFrCU8CVitJomq9QVAduUrZ
transaction
d616914b875f3e19aedf4b5a59d43e3fb1bf0796cc526c63ff5b41c075c30f57
spent
true